Apples to Oranges
January 10, 2009

Found a great article today on the difference between devotional and exegetical study of scripture.
Exegetical study: “This way of reading Scripture has as its goal understanding the meaning of the biblical text for the larger purpose of drawing theological, doctrinal, or homiletical conclusions from it. It involves using various methods of biblical study, such as: [...]
